Show POOL CHAMPION IS LIVING HERE J. L. Malone, Who Holds the World's Record as Pool Player, Now Calls Salt LaKe Home. : ( : Salt Lake City is now the home of J. L. Malone, champion pool player of the world for eight years. The renowned 4J'.' L." for many" years met the pool experts of the world in New York and defeated such good men with the cue as DOro,, Clearwater, Frank Powers, Werner, iKnight, Frey and Sutton. . Sutton is now champion billiard player of the world, having defeated Slosson and Jake Schaefer. That's the kind of timber Malone went up against; : and won out. Powers also was a champion cham-pion at one time. D'Oro is the present champion pool player of the world. For eight years Malone was billiard and pool instructor at the Denver Athletic Ath-letic club, and gave many exhibitions of his wonderful 'skill in pushing the ivories around. "The best hold, in my opinion," said Malone todav, "for billiard and pool players is a loose one, because the fingers fin-gers close instinctively when the stroke is applied. Players in this city, with but few exceptions, hold cues too hard." Malone .will play a handicap match Friday" night in tne new poolroom, 53 West Second South street, with Sib Freeman, the former having to run 100 before the latter gets 75. Since Malone 'a arrival here, interest in billiards and pool has greatly increased in-creased and several tournaments are likely to be-held this season between ball and cue experts. |
